The Organisation

Verdant Supply and Governance Limited is a procurement outsourcing and advisory firm registered in the Federal Republic of Nigeria (CAC RC9506611). We provide specialist procurement management, compliance and governance, and sustainability advisory services to institutional clients operating within donor-funded and development finance frameworks across West Africa.

Our work sits at the intersection of technical procurement practice and institutional accountability — where the quality of a process, the completeness of a document trail, and the integrity of a vendor relationship are not administrative details, but the difference between a project that delivers and one that unravels under scrutiny.

How We Were Founded

“Verdant was not founded to fill a gap on a business plan. It was founded because the gap was impossible to ignore.”

Over four years of managing procurement for donor-funded projects across West Africa, a pattern became clear. The technical knowledge required to run compliant processes was available, but unevenly distributed. Large implementing organisations had institutional memory. Smaller partners and NGOs navigated complex donor rules under-resourced, precisely when compliance failures carry the heaviest consequences.

Simultaneously, the advisory market was fragmented. International consultancies lacked regional specificity, while local firms lacked donor-financed technical depth. The organisation that combined both largely did not exist in the accessible form the sector needed.

Verdant was formed to be that organisation.

What We Believe

We hold a set of convictions that shape how we work and what we build:

Compliance must be documented.

In donor-funded procurement, what happened matters less than what can be demonstrated. We are meticulous about documentation because it is the only durable evidence of process integrity.

Procurement is governance.

Decisions on who wins and through what mechanism determine where resources flow. We treat every procurement engagement as a governance matter, not a transactional one.

Sustainability belongs inside.

ESG commitments are only as real as operational procurement decisions. We embed sustainability criteria directly into specifications, assessments, and contracts.

Expertise should be accessible.

A lean, specialist external firm that delivers the standard of a well-resourced internal function — without the fixed cost — is a structural answer to a structural problem.
